Harvester

Harvesting machines are technical devices with different degrees of automation for harvesting agricultural products. They enable the harvest to be brought in rationally and reduce personnel, time and thus also economic expenditure. One of the most famous harvesting machines is the combine harvester . However, there are also machines for many other agricultural products that support harvesting work.
Harvester
Harvesting machines are understood to be agricultural harvesting machines which, due to the technical scope of their functions, have the property of taking over a large proportion of human manual labor during the agricultural harvest through technical-mechanical functions. The property of your own drive system is not absolutely necessary for this (as is the case with a self-propelled machine, for example ). In this respect, the driving function is not a necessary but sufficient condition for a harvester.
Early harvesting machines, on the other hand, were pulled by draft animals , and the machine was driven by the wheels. The threshing machines , which can only be used stationary, were operated by a locomobile or a Göpel , but later also by means of a tractor.
